To: GnuThere
How long is the vote open once the role call starts?

Typically, 15 minutes.

On occasion, they may keep the vote open to accommodate someone who is rushing to the floor (might be someone in a meeting with House members or lobbyists), but I don't think "rushing to the floor" includes being on a flight from Montana.
